THE ROLE & THE TEAM
Our teams in ZMS own the platform which enables Zalando partners to run onsite advertising campaigns on the Zalando web and mobile apps. Our solutions help fashion brands to reach Zalando customers via authentic content, tell their story, provide inspiration and drive engagement. Learn more about our tech teams here.
As a Software Engineer (Full-Stack) in the ZMS Consumer Experience team, you will develop solutions and create experiences for hundreds of partners and internal users and millions of Zalando customers, including customer-facing advertising formats featured on Zalando home and catalog premises, landing page experiences for brand storytelling, as well as partner-facing content and media management workflows.
You will be working alongside a cross-functional team and collaborate closely with Product Managers, UX Designers, Frontend and Full-Stack Engineers, Data and Product Analysts, all collaborating to drive innovation and success.
Please note: This is a full-stack role in the real sense, where the primary focus is on the backend, but there will be many instances where certain projects require pure frontend skills. Therefore, experience on both the backend and frontend are necessary to be successful in this role (think of it as a 60%:40% split backend to frontend).
INCLUSIVE BY DESIGN
At Zalando, our vision is to be inclusive by design. And this vision starts with our hiring - we do not discriminate on the basis of gender identity, sexual orientation, personal expression, ethnicity, religious belief, or disability status. You are welcome to leave out your picture, age, or marital status from your application. We only assess candidates on their qualifications and merit.
We want to provide you with a great candidate experience. Feel free to inform us of any accommodations you may need, so we can best support you throughout the hiring process.
do.BETTER - our diversity & inclusion strategy: https://corporate.zalando.com/en/our-impact/dobetter-our-diversity-and-inclusion-strategy
Our employee resource groups: https://corporate.zalando.com/en/our-impact/our-employee-resource-groups
WHAT WE’D LOVE YOU TO DO (AND LOVE DOING
Design, build and evolve scalable full-stack solutions powering customer-facing advertising experiences and partner-facing content workflows used by millions of Zalando customers.
Own backend-heavy features (around 60%) while confidently contributing to frontend development (around 40%) when strong UI and UX skills are needed.
Collaborate closely with Product Managers, UX Designers, Data Analysts and Engineers to turn product ideas and business needs into robust technical solutions.
Build and improve APIs, data models and persistence layers, ensuring high performance, scalability and reliability.
Create accessible and performant frontend experiences using React and modern web standards.
Improve system performance, observability and reliability by applying DevOps best practices and contributing to CI/CD and cloud-native infrastructure.
Break down complex problems into iterative, value-driven solutions while maintaining a high bar for code quality and simplicity.
Share knowledge, mentor other engineers and contribute to technical discussions that shape the future of the ZMS Consumer Experience platform.
WE'D LOVE TO MEET YOU IF
You have 4+ years of experience building full-stack web applications, ideally using Node.js and TypeScript
You’re comfortable working across the stack, including React, core web fundamentals (HTML, CSS, browser concepts), and backend systems
You have strong experience with relational data modeling, SQL, and data persistence using RDBMS
You design, evaluate, and optimize scalable, reliable systems with a focus on performance, throughput, and latency
You apply modern DevOps best practices, including CI/CD, observability, Docker, Kubernetes, and common AWS services
You communicate clearly about complex technical and architectural topics with diverse stakeholders
You can break down large problems into smaller, iterative solutions that deliver customer value
You enjoy mentoring junior and intermediate engineers and helping remove blockers
Bonus: experience with other backend languages Java or Python, deep JavaScript knowledge, GraphQL, Express.js, testing practices, or data engineering concepts.
If you think you have what it takes, we encourage you to apply even if you don't meet every single requirement. You may just be the right candidate for this or other roles!
OUR OFFER
Zalando provides a range of benefits, here’s an overview of what you can expect.
Employee shares program
40% off fashion and beauty products sold and shipped by Zalando, 30% off Zalando Lounge, discounts from external partners
2 paid volunteering days a year
Hybrid working model with 60% remote per week, actual practice is up to each team to best support their collaboration
Work from abroad for up to 30 working days a year
27 days of vacation a year (for Zalando SE)
Relocation assistance available (subject to prior agreement)
Family services, including counseling and support
Health and wellbeing options (including Gympass)
Mental health support and coaching available
Learn all about Zalando and our values here: https://jobs.zalando.com/en/?gh_src=22377bdd1us

